The hallmarks of ancient Chinese civilization include Metallurgy, Urban Centers, and Writing. However, Baroque Sculpture is not a hallmark of ancient Chinese civilization. The Baroque period is a European art and architecture movement that developed in the 17th century, much later than the ancient Chinese civilization. Therefore, the answer is Baroque Sculpture.
